7215199 Angel, flying, with cup and wine flask (Ink, color wash and gold on paper) by Ottoman School, (16th century); 18 x 13.5 cm; Freer Gallery of Art, Smithsonian Institution, USA; (add.info.: Attributed to Shah Quli
Ottoman period, mid-16th century); Freer Gallery of Art, Smithsonian Institution; Purchase -- Charles Lang Freer Endowment

This print showcases a mesmerizing artwork titled "Angel, flying, with cup and wine flask" created by the Ottoman School in the 16th century. The piece, measuring 18 x 13.5 cm, is housed at the prestigious Freer Gallery of Art in the Smithsonian Institution in the USA. The intricate details of this masterpiece are brought to life through ink, color wash, and gold on paper. Attributed to Shah Quli from the mid-16th century Ottoman period, this artwork exudes elegance and sophistication. The angel depicted in this composition is portrayed gracefully soaring through the heavens while holding a cup and wine flask. The delicate use of gold adds a touch of opulence to this celestial scene. With its rich historical significance and artistic finesse, this artwork offers a glimpse into Turkey's cultural heritage during the 16th century Ottoman era. Its exquisite craftsmanship exemplifies the mastery achieved by artists during that time.
